Join us.About the Team:The Avionics team is responsible for the full lifecycle of Terran R's nervous system, designing, building, testing, installing, and operating the hardware that connects and controls every major electrical system on the vehicle and ground. The team's structure intentionally combines avionics design, manufacturing, and test to enable rapid iteration and feedback loops. Engineers are deeply embedded into other functions within Relativity, working closely with propulsion, GNC, fluids, and stage engineering teams to ensure seamless integration and operation. Now is a unique time to join: you'll get to help shape Terran R's fundamental avionics architecture and be given a high degree of ownership on components that will fly.About the Role:As a Principal Avionics Test Engineer, you will provide technical leadership across the Avionics and Software teams to drive a cohesive and effective test program for component, system, and vehicle level test:Manage requirements and derive verification plans at the component and system-level to ensure the team delivers a functional avionics systemDrive the development of common hardware components (simulators, data acquisition systems, etc.) for use in component and system testDrive the development of common software frameworks (test sequence automation, data review tools, configuration management software, etc.) for use in component, system, and vehicle testSet technical strategy for development, ATP, and QTP functional, performance, and environmental testingHelp lead vehicle-level integration and test activities including on-console operations, data review, and troubleshootingLead electrical and software system validation efforts leveraging hardware-in-the-loop (HITL) and similar test platformsAbout You:Undergraduate or graduate degree (BS/MS/PhD) in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Computer Science, Aerospace Engineering, or a related field20+ years of experience in electrical or aerospace component and/or systems testExperience applying expertise in environmental test standards such as SMC-S-016, RCC-319, RCC-324, DO-160, or MIL-STD-810Experience applying expertise in environmental test equipment such as thermal chambers, shaker tables, vacuum chambers, etc.Demonstrated experience leading system-level design verification of complex electrical systems (e.g. integrated power system testing, communication system testing, etc.)Experience with basic software development tools and frameworks such as Python, Git, etc.Nice to haves but not required:Experience with production work order or MES systemsFamiliarity with telemetry standards such as IRIG-106 or CCSDS standardsExperience leading vehicle-level test campaigns for rockets, spacecraft, or aircraftAt Relativity Space, we are committed to transparency and fairness in our compensation practices.
